Submitted by fantum on Mon, 03/10/2008 - 2:49pm.
A new website exists (Beta) which allows persons to rate individual police officers.
The site is: www.ratemycop.com
Olympia is listed.
Police in general are not happy.
See this story:
http://abclocal.go.com/kgo/story?section=news/local&id=6006207
Of course, the 1st Admendment should trump any challenge to the posting of publicly available information concerning those that protect and serve. If they are good officers then they should have nothing to hide.
